Selecting Nitrile Glove Powder Options

When selecting nitrile gloves, you'll often encounter different powder options. These powders are included to enhance the wearer's comfort and make it easier to put on the gloves. The most widespread powder types encompass cornstarch, silicon dioxide, and synthetic powders formulated for particular skin. Cornstarch is a traditional choice known for its capacity to absorb moisture. Talc offers excellent slippery feeling, suitable for tasks where resistance is a concern. Synthetic powders are engineered to minimize any potential allergies.

Ultimately, the best powder choice depends on your personal needs and the precise application.
